Joaquin Niemann cools off, but holds on to LIV Golf New York lead

Jul 17, 2026; Southport, ENG; Joaquin Niemann plays his shot from a bunker by the tenth green during the second round of The Open Championship golf tournament at Royal Birkdale. Mandatory Credit: Bill Streicher-Imagn Images

After a pair of blistering rounds, Joaquin Niemann cooled off on Saturday yet clung to a two-stroke lead after three rounds of the LIV Golf New York event in Bedminster, N.J.

The Chilean stands at 14-under-par 199 after his third-round 70, but his lead shrank from five strokes to two during the third round as Harold Varner III vaulted up the leaderboard with a 65 at Trump National Golf Club.

Englishman Lee Westwood duplicated his Thursday round of 2-under 69 to drop into solo third at 10 under par. Westwood is three shots clear of Northern Ireland’s Tom McKibbin (70), while Spain’s Sergio Garcia (72) dropped eight shots off the pace.

The team scores took a beating in the windy conditions. Niemann’s Torque GC is the lone team under par at 1-under after amassing an 8-over score on Saturday. McKibbin’s Legion XIII side lapped the field with a 4-under round and closed to within two strokes.

Niemann, who played bogey-free golf through 36 holes while posting rounds of 64 and 65, opened with a double-bogey 6 after his drive on the 514-yard par 4 went out of bounds to the right.

He shot 36 on the front nine after solving the outward half in 30 on Thursday and Friday.

Niemann, looking for his ninth LIV Golf individual title, steadied himself on the inward half. He made birdies at Nos. 12 and 15, but another wayward drive cost him an opportunity for birdie on the finishing hole, a 580-yard par 5.

“I mean, it was a pretty good last 17 holes,” Niemann said. “Obviously not the best start. But pretty proud and happy the way I played today, especially coming into the end of the round.”

Varner started the day tied with McKibbin for fourth place, seven shots behind Niemann. He posted the lowest round of the day by a margin of three shots, making four birdies on the front nine on the way to a bogey-free round.

“Yeah, obviously it suits my game,” said Varner about the Bedminster layout. “It’s playing really long right now. Obviously it’s — I don’t know how long it is, but it’s an advantage for me. It’s a great opportunity to do something well.

“I feel like I’ve been playing well, and tomorrow is going to be a great chance.”

Westwood admitted to some fatigue coming down the stretch on a blustery day. He was at 12 under through 12 holes, but took a double bogey on No. 14 and a bogey at 16.

“I’m just pleased to be in good enough shape, my game still be at an elite level where I can compete with these guys that are some of the best in the world,” Westwood said. “Joaco is one of the best players in the world, in my eyes. You’ve got Jon Rahm and Bryson and Tyrrell, and they’re not even in contention this week.

“At 53 years of age, I think it’s quite an achievement to still be mixing it with the youngsters. If you go out there and watch us all playing, I’m giving up quite an advantage off the tee. Not all the time, I get the occasional one out there, but in general, I’m playing a different golf course, really.”

Niemann plans to carry an admirable attitude into the final round.

“I mean, just be grateful,” Niemann said. “I feel like if I just remember the good things that I have around me and the people around me, it’s just easy to go back to sleep. I have a good life.”
